Detailed Description
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.
Humans are at the end of the food chain, thus they are exposed to the highest doses of these compounds. EDs have been detected in human adipose tissue and biological fluids such as: serum, urine, milk and amniotic fluid .
Additionally, it has been proven that BPA can also directly stimulate androgen synthesis in the ovarian theca-interstitial cells. A correlation between increased serum testosterone levels observed in women with PCOS with serum BPA concentrations has also been found .

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
* Females
* Diagnosed a case of polycystic ovary syndrome
Exclusion Criteria
* Cardiovascular disease
* Neoplasms
* Current smoking, diabetes mellitus,
* Renal impairment (serum creatinine 120 mol/liter), and hypertension (blood pressure 140/85 mm Hg).
